The mass of an object is a property that cannot be changed by a force. Mass is a measure of the amount of matter in an object and is constant regardless of the force acting on it.
The mass of a body cannot be changed when a force is applied to it. The force may cause the body to move or accelerate, but the mass remains constant.

The fact that we cannot see around a corner is due to the property of light called "line of sight." Light travels in straight lines, and when an object blocks our direct line of sight, we are unable to see beyond that obstruction.

No, you cannot quitclaim property to yourself because quitclaim deeds are used to transfer a property's ownership interest from one party to another. Since you cannot transfer property to yourself, a quitclaim deed is not necessary.

A property owner cannot place a lien on his/her own property. To create a voluntary lien on property the owner must agree to transfer an interest to the creditor until the debt has been paid. When the debt has been paid the creditor executes a release of their interest in the property. A conveyance to yourself would be null and void because there would be, in legal terms, a merger of title. You cannot convey to yourself what you already own. There would be no conveyance.
You cannot give yourself an easement over property that you yourself own unless you are simultaneously selling the part of the property with the easement on it to someone else, and that buyer agrees to the easement. Otherwise, you already own the property, so the law already recognizes you as the total owner, i.e. you don't need an easement over land you already own.
